WebbSelective mutism is most common in children under age 5. The cause, or causes, are unknown. Most experts believe that children with the condition inherit a tendency to be anxious and inhibited. Most children with selective mutism have some form of extreme social fear ( phobia ). Parents often think that the child is choosing not to speak.

Det här är den första svenska handboken om selektiv … ps5 cheats for modern warfareWebbMyth 2: Children with selective mutism are shy and will outgrow their difficulties speaking to others. Selective mutism is not the same thing as being shy. Lots of children are shy. Kids who are shy tend to warm up to new situations over time.
